Miami Hurricanes Football: Next Man Up At Linebacker

The Miami Hurricanes suffered a huge loss after team captain and senior defensive leader, Raphael Kirby suffered a season-ending knee injury against Virginia Tech (Click Here to read about Kirby’s injury).

This comes as a bigger blow after already losing starting linebacker Darrion Owens for the year (also, a knee injury) and the uncertainty of linebacker Marques Gayot who suffered a scary neck injury during practice in late September.

The Hurricanes are thin at linebacker. Nonetheless, the defense must find a way to stick together, especially that we’re in the midst of conference play and facing off against the explosive, #6 ranked Clemson next Saturday.
